Output ef64597737edb596c0859b337bd99e206c72a6035474fe09e5473783a74e49ea:1

value
3022766
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d064aa3217d661300c564ca4eb0b4bc942693d25 OP_EQUALVERIFY OP_CHECKSIG
address
1Kzt9DVznD88iWX1AiZLboz6Jmqjbxcygh
transaction
ef64597737edb596c0859b337bd99e206c72a6035474fe09e5473783a74e49ea
spent
true